And then there were three. Just the other week the short list for the role of Captain America hit the web. Well, it seems as though that list has gotten even shorter. Both The Good Guys’ Scott Porter and Michael Cassidy of the CW’s Privileged are out of the running leaving us with John Krasinski, Mike Vogel, Patrick Flueger, Chace Crawford and Garret Hedlund.

While that list and the concept that the actor awarded the role would sign a contract to play the part in a whopping nine films is questionable, Porter and Cassidy’s exits are not. Porter has opted to lead the CW pilot called Nomads and Cassidy flat out said – er, tweeted, “No Captain America for me.”
